10 Game-Changing Web Application Frameworks You Need to Know in 2026

Author

Mahipal Nehra

Author

Publish Date

Publish Date

14 Nov 2025

Find the top 10 frameworks for web application development in 2026 with real survey data, use cases and expert guidance to help you pick the best tech stack for your next web app.

Top 10 Frameworks for Web Application Development

Quick Summary:

Choosing a web framework in 2026 is not just a technical decision. It is a business decision that affects your speed to market, hiring strategy, security posture and total cost of ownership. With JavaScript, Python, Java, PHP and .NET all still going strong, your challenge is not a lack of choice. Your challenge is cutting through the noise and picking a stack that fits your product and your team.

In this guide, we break down what a web application framework is, why frameworks still matter in an era of AI and low code, and how to choose the right one. Then we walk through 10 frameworks that are actually relevant in 2026: React, Next.js, Angular, Vue, Express, Django, Laravel, Spring Boot, ASP.NET Core and Ruby on Rails. For each framework, you get:

  • Where it fits best

  • When to avoid it

  • How it looks in real world use

Along the way, we add survey data, a comparison table, internal resources you already have on Decipher Zone, and a couple of planning exercises so this article can be used as a decision tool, not just a listicle.


What is a Web Application Framework

A web application framework is a reusable foundation that gives you a structured way to build web applications. Instead of writing everything from scratch, you plug into a system that already knows how to handle routing, controllers, views, database access, security and configuration. You still write the business logic, but you do not reinvent the plumbing.

A good framework usually defines a clear project structure. It tells you where controllers live, how models interact with the database, how templates are rendered and how requests move through the stack. This structure is what keeps large projects maintainable as multiple developers join, leave and modify the code over years.

Modern frameworks also come with extra capabilities that would take months to build on your own, such as:

  • Authentication and authorisation

  • Form handling and validation

  • Internationalisation and localisation

  • Background jobs and task queues

  • Testing utilities and debugging tools

If you want a deeper conceptual overview, your existing article on web app development frameworks and their benefits already explains why frameworks matter, their components and best practices for using them in real projects. 

The short version is simple. A framework lets your development team focus on business value instead of wiring the basics of a web server again and again.

Top 10 Frameworks For Web Application

Why Frameworks Still Matter in 2026

With AI assisted coding, low code platforms and serverless backends, it is fair to ask if traditional frameworks are still worth the effort. The data says they are.

Stack Overflow’s 2024 technology survey shows that JavaScript remains the most used programming language, with Node.js at 44.2 percent usage, React at 36.6 percent, Express at 19.3 percent and Next.js at 17.9 percent among respondents. Django, Spring Boot, Angular, ASP.NET Core and Laravel all appear in the same ranking group, which means they are far from legacy technology. 

In 2025, Stack Overflow also reported that Python adoption grew by 7 percentage points year on year, mainly because of its strength in AI, data science and backend tasks. This directly reinforces the importance of Python based frameworks such as Django for AI enabled web applications.

From a business perspective, frameworks still matter because they:

  • Encode security and performance best practices into defaults

  • Give you predictable release and upgrade paths through long term support

  • Make hiring easier because you align with widely known tools

  • Plug into modern DevOps and observability infrastructure

AI tools can generate code, but they generate it inside framework conventions. Low code tools are good for experiments, but serious applications still need a well understood core that a team can maintain. Frameworks are that core.

How To Choose The Right Framework For Your Web App

Instead of starting with “which framework is best”, start with “what are we really building and who will maintain it”.

1. Clarify your product and constraints

Before comparing React, Django or Laravel, write down:

  • What type of product you are building, such as marketplace, SaaS dashboard, internal tool or content heavy site

  • Whether you need search engine visibility, real time collaboration or complex workflows

  • Any non negotiable constraints, such as regulatory compliance, geography or hosting preferences

If you are still in the idea phase, your blog on web app development ideas for startups is a useful starting point for mapping ideas to typical technology stacks and monetisation models. 

How To Choose The Right Framework For Your Web App

2. Look at your team’s skills and the hiring market

The best framework on paper will fail if no one on your team can work with it confidently. Survey data shows that JavaScript, Python and Java remain very strong in both popularity and growth. That means React, Next.js, Express, Django and Spring Boot are usually safe choices when you think about future hiring.

Ask questions like:

  • Which languages does our team already use in production

  • What does the local or remote hiring market look like for each framework

  • Can we support a more complex stack like Spring Boot or ASP.NET Core operationally

For a non technical founder or manager, the article on how to hire web application developers breaks this down in business friendly terms, comparing in house, freelance and outsourced models.

3. Map your needs to framework strengths

Different frameworks shine in different scenarios. For example:

  • React and Next.js excel at rich frontends and SEO oriented applications

  • Express works well for lightweight APIs and microservices in Node.js

  • Django is perfect when you need data heavy dashboards and AI assisted features

  • Laravel is strong for PHP based business apps and ecommerce

  • Spring Boot and ASP.NET Core are ideal for complex enterprise backends

If you want a more backend centric view of this mapping, your guide to backend frameworks for web development compares several options by architecture, performance and use cases.

Once you understand your product, your team and the strengths of each framework, the choice becomes much clearer.

Top 10 Frameworks For Web Application Development in 2026

The list below reflects current usage data, developer sentiment and real world experience, not just marketing pages.

1. React

React is still the most influential UI library in 2026. It powers countless frontends, from simple marketing sites to complex SaaS dashboards. Although it is technically a library, most developers treat it as the foundation of a full framework stack because of its ecosystem and patterns.

React uses a component based model and a virtual DOM to make UI updates predictable and efficient. Developers appreciate how JSX lets them compose logic and markup in one place, and large teams value the ecosystem of routing, state management and testing tools built around React.

Use React when you:

  • Need highly interactive interfaces with reusable components

  • Plan to support both web and mobile using React Native

  • Want flexibility to choose your own routing and data fetching strategy

Keep in mind that React alone does not give you routing, data loading or server rendering. For SEO heavy sites and more opinionated structure, many teams combine React with Next.js.

Top 10 Frameworks For Web Application

2. Next.js

Next.js is the full stack React framework that adds routing, server side rendering, static generation, image optimisation and simple API routes on top of React. Stack Overflow’s 2024 survey shows Next.js among the most commonly used web frameworks with 17.9 percent usage, reflecting its growing adoption for production web apps. 

Next.js makes it easier to deliver fast, SEO friendly pages by handling server rendering, caching and incremental static regeneration automatically. Its file based router and convention over configuration approach simplify project structure without locking you into a rigid pattern.

Use Next.js when you:

  • Build marketing sites, SaaS apps or dashboards that require both SEO and rich interactions

  • Need a single codebase for server and client logic

  • Prefer an opinionated but still flexible way to integrate React on the server

You still have to design your backend architecture. For example, you might place domain heavy logic into separate microservices, or you may consume external APIs. To understand how this fits into the bigger picture, your article on web application architecture explains common patterns such as layered architecture, modular monoliths and microservices. 

3. Angular

Angular is a full featured frontend framework maintained by Google. It uses TypeScript, dependency injection and a strong module system to help teams build large single page applications with predictable structure. While some developers prefer lighter options, Angular continues to be popular in enterprises that need consistent patterns across big teams.

Angular ships with its own router, form handling, HTTP client and testing tools. That means you do not need to assemble these pieces yourself, which can be a real advantage when onboarding new developers or maintaining strict standards.

Use Angular when you:

  • Build complex internal dashboards, admin panels or enterprise portals

  • Want strong built in conventions rather than picking libraries for every concern

  • Value TypeScript first design and clear separation of modules

The trade off is a steeper learning curve. Teams coming from plain JavaScript sometimes find Angular heavy at first, but once they adopt its patterns it becomes a very productive environment for large code bases.

4. Vue

Vue is a progressive framework that lets you start small and scale up. You can add Vue to a single widget in an existing application, or use it to build a full single page app with Vue Router and a state management solution like Pinia. Many developers describe Vue as a comfortable middle ground between the structure of Angular and the flexibility of React.

Vue uses a template based syntax, which feels familiar to developers who are used to HTML and classic templating systems. It also plays nicely with both JavaScript and TypeScript, which makes gradual adoption easier.

Use Vue when you:

  • Need to modernise an older server rendered app without rewriting everything

  • Want a gentle learning curve for teams that are new to modern frontend frameworks

  • Prefer a more opinionated template syntax instead of JSX

Developer sentiment data from recent frontend surveys and community discussions often shows Vue with very high satisfaction scores, even when its raw usage numbers are smaller than React. 

5. Express.js

Express.js is the minimal but powerful web framework that sits on top of Node.js. It provides a straightforward way to define routes, middlewares and controllers without forcing a particular structure for your application. Despite its small core, Express appears in the Stack Overflow 2024 survey as one of the most used web technologies with 19.3 percent usage. 

Express is often used as the backend in JavaScript heavy stacks that pair it with React, Vue or Angular on the frontend. It is also a common choice for small services that expose REST or GraphQL APIs.

Use Express when you:

  • Want a simple, flexible backend in JavaScript or TypeScript

  • Build APIs, microservices or backend for frontend layers

  • Prefer to define your own folder structure and conventions

Because Express is unopinionated, you must enforce your own best practices for logging, security and error handling.

6. Django

Django is a high level Python framework that follows the “batteries included” philosophy. It provides an ORM, routing, templates, authentication, an admin interface and many security features out of the box. This makes it a strong choice for data heavy business applications and dashboards.

Python continues to gain adoption thanks to AI and data science, and that growth spills into web development. Stack Overflow When you pair Django with Python’s ecosystem for analytics, machine learning and automation, you get a powerful platform for intelligent web applications.

Use Django when you:

  • Need a secure, data heavy application with complex business rules

  • Want to integrate AI models, analytics or scientific pipelines into your web app

  • Prefer explicit, readable code and strong documentation

Django is excellent for monolithic applications that may later be split into services. To understand how backend frameworks like Django compare with others in terms of performance and architecture, the article on backend frameworks for web development is worth revisiting from a historical perspective.

Top 10 Frameworks For Web Application

7. Laravel

Laravel has become the modern standard for PHP web application development. It wraps routing, Eloquent ORM, templating, queues, events and more into an elegant, consistent framework. For organisations that already use PHP for legacy systems or content sites, Laravel is often the fastest way to build modern, maintainable applications.

Laravel also comes with an ecosystem of first party tools such as Horizon, Nova and Telescope, which help with job monitoring, admin panels and debugging. This reduces the amount of custom infrastructure you need to build.

Use Laravel when you:

  • Operate in a PHP heavy environment and want a modern framework

  • Build business applications, content platforms or ecommerce

  • Need quick scaffolding with good developer experience

If PHP is one of your core skills, it makes sense to align Laravel based projects with your dedicated PHP development services, where you already describe how your team handles architecture, migrations and long term support for PHP stacks.

8. Spring Boot

Spring Boot is the backbone of many enterprise Java systems. It reduces the boilerplate associated with traditional Spring configuration and helps you create production ready services with sensible defaults. Banks, telecoms, logistics platforms and large SaaS providers still rely heavily on Spring Boot for critical workloads.

Spring Boot integrates with a wide range of data stores, messaging systems and cloud platforms. It also has strong support for microservices patterns, including centralised configuration, service discovery and distributed tracing when combined with Spring Cloud.

Use Spring Boot when you:

  • Build complex enterprise systems with many integrations

  • Need strict runtime performance and reliability

  • Already have Java or Kotlin expertise in your organisation

To complement this, your blog on web app development process outlines how planning, architecture and testing stages work in a typical project, which is especially relevant for enterprise scale Spring Boot initiatives.

9. ASP.NET Core

ASP.NET Core is Microsoft’s cross platform framework for building modern web apps and APIs with C sharp and .NET. It runs on Linux, Windows and containers, and appears in the Stack Overflow 2024 survey as one of the notable web frameworks with 7.4 percent usage among respondents. 

ASP.NET Core is designed for high performance and can handle very high throughput when tuned correctly. Its strong static typing, tooling and ecosystem around Visual Studio Make it a favourite in organisations that have invested in the Microsoft stack.

Use ASP.NET Core when you:

  • Operate in a .NET centric environment

  • Need secure, high performance APIs or web apps

  • Value mature tooling, libraries and integration options

Many government, healthcare and financial institutions choose ASP.NET Core because it aligns with their existing infrastructure and security standards.

Web App Frameworks

10. Ruby on Rails

Ruby on Rails is the veteran on this list, but it is far from obsolete. It is still one of the fastest paths from idea to production for CRUD heavy applications. Rails introduced the convention over configuration approach that many other frameworks later adopted.

Rails comes with a powerful ORM, migrations, background job support, mailers and a clear MVC structure. The focus on developer happiness tends to produce readable, concise code, which is ideal for small teams that iterate quickly.

Use Rails when you:

  • Build products where time to market and iteration speed are critical

  • Need a robust admin area and traditional web interface

  • Want clear conventions that reduce decision fatigue for new developers

Usage numbers for Rails are smaller than React or Django in recent surveys, but its ecosystem and philosophy still make it a strong option for teams that love Ruby. 

Free Consultation

Comparison Table of The Top Frameworks

FrameworkLayerLanguageTypical use casesLearning curveBest suited for
ReactFrontendJavaScript, TSComplex UIs, dashboards, SPAsMediumProduct teams focused on rich interfaces
Next.jsFull stack webJavaScript, TSSEO heavy sites, SaaS, hybrid appsMediumTeams standardising on React for server and client
AngularFrontendTypeScriptEnterprise SPAs, admin panelsMedium highLarger teams needing strong conventions
VueFrontendJS, TSGradual migration, mid sized SPAsLow mediumTeams seeking gentle learning curve
Express.jsBackendJS, TS (Node)APIs, microservices, BFFsLowJavaScript teams building lightweight backends
DjangoBackend fullPythonData heavy apps, dashboards, AI driven productsMediumTeams combining web development with data science
LaravelBackend fullPHPBusiness apps, ecommerce, content platformsMediumOrganisations modernising PHP based systems
Spring BootBackendJava, KotlinEnterprise systems, microservices, integrationsHighEnterprises with strong Java expertise
ASP.NET CoreBackendC sharp (.NET)Enterprise apps, high performance APIsMedium highMicrosoft centric organisations
Ruby on RailsBackend fullRubySaaS products, internal tools, CRUD heavy appsMediumTeams optimising for developer productivity

If you want to understand how these choices impact budget, your article on affordable web app development for small businesses explains how tech stacks, complexity and team models translate into real costs and timelines.

Read: Low-Cost MVP Development for European Tech Startups

Framework Trends You Cannot Ignore in 2026

Even though the top frameworks look familiar, how we use them keeps changing. Three patterns stand out.

1. TypeScript First Mindsets

More teams are treating TypeScript as the default rather than an optional add on. This especially affects React, Next.js, Angular and modern Node backends. Typed code makes refactoring large frontends and microservices safer and is frequently highlighted in community discussions as a major productivity boost. Reddit+1

2. Meta Frameworks as The New Normal

Instead of gluing many small libraries together, teams adopt meta frameworks that provide routing, rendering and data fetching patterns. Next.js is the most obvious example, but Nuxt, Remix and SvelteKit follow the same idea. These frameworks sit on top of React or Vue and make server side rendering and streaming much easier.

3. Developer Sentiment and UGC Signals

It is not enough to read official documentation. Real world experience shows up in community spaces. For example, this community discussion about State of JavaScript front end frameworks captures how developers feel about React, Vue, Angular and emerging options after years of working with them.

When you combine survey data with these user generated conversations, you get a realistic picture of how maintainable and enjoyable each framework is for long lived projects.

Planning Exercise: Use This Guide With Your Team

Use this quick exercise as a practical workshop.

  1. List your top three business goals for the web app. For example, “launch MVP in three months, support 10 thousand users, integrate with two core systems”.

  2. Decide whether SEO, real time collaboration or complex workflows are your top technical priority. You cannot optimise for everything at once.

  3. Pick two frontend candidates and two backend candidates from the comparison table that match your language preferences.

  4. For each candidate, find at least one public project or case study using that framework and review its architecture.

  5. Shortlist one frontend and one backend framework that your team feels confident adopting in the next six to twelve months.

If you want a more end to end view that connects frameworks with product planning and launch steps, your article on building a web application step by step is a good companion.

Frameworks For Web Application

The goal is not to pick a perfect stack. The goal is to pick a sensible stack that your team can use effectively.

Read: The Cost of Building an MVP

How We Can Help You in Choosing The Right Framework For Your Web Application

Framework selection is only part of the puzzle. You still need information architecture, UX design, security, CI and deployments. Many companies decide it is more efficient to bring in a specialist partner for architecture and development while they focus on domain knowledge and customer insights.

A partner like Decipher Zone, already positioned as a custom web application development company, can help you:

  • Evaluate frameworks based on your goals, team and budget

  • Design scalable architectures that work well with your chosen stack

  • Implement end to end solutions with proper testing, monitoring and documentation

Because you are already offering web and mobile solutions to global clients, this article can act as a bridge between your educational content and your service pages. Readers who feel overwhelmed by choices now have a clear next step if they want expert help.

Choose Your Next Step

If you are still reading, you probably have a project in mind. Take a moment and decide which of these three actions you want to take next.

  • Save this article and share it with your technical and business stakeholders. Ask everyone to highlight one framework they like and one they do not.

  • Open three tabs: one for your top frontend choice, one for your top backend choice and one Decipher Zone guide from the links above. Skim each for ten minutes and note what feels strong or confusing.

  • Create a one page brief that describes your idea, constraints, team skills and any existing systems, then map it against two or three stacks from this article.

If you find that the more you read, the more questions you have, that is a sign you have moved from generic research into real solution design, which is exactly where expert partners add value.

Web Application Development


FAQs


1. Which framework is best overall for web application development in 2026

There is no universal best framework. For many modern projects, React plus Next.js on the frontend and either Express, Django, Laravel, Spring Boot or ASP.NET Core on the backend form powerful combinations. Stack Overflow data shows strong usage for React, Node.js, Express, Next.js and several backend frameworks, which means you are not choosing from obscure tools. 

The right choice depends on your language preference, your team, and the type of application you are building.

2. Which framework should I choose for an AI or data heavy web app

Django is a natural choice for AI or analytics heavy projects because it runs on Python, which is the go to language for AI and data science in recent surveys. Stack Overflow You can integrate models, data pipelines and notebooks into a single stack without constant context switching. For highly interactive frontends you can pair Django with React or Vue.

3. Which frameworks work best for enterprise scale systems

Spring Boot and ASP.NET Core are designed with enterprise concerns in mind. They offer robust security libraries, mature integration options and excellent performance profiles. Express.js, Django and Laravel are also used in enterprise environments, but Java and .NET remain popular in sectors like banking, insurance and government because of their long history and tooling.

4. Can I mix multiple frameworks in one project

Yes. It is very common to use one framework for the frontend and another for the backend, such as React or Angular on the client side and Django, Laravel, Express or Spring Boot on the server. Larger organisations often have multiple backends written in different frameworks as microservices. The important thing is to keep clear boundaries and well documented APIs between them.

5. How do I keep my framework choice future proof

You cannot freeze the ecosystem in place, but you can reduce risk by:

  • Choosing popular languages with active communities

  • Picking frameworks that have clear roadmaps and long term support policies

  • Keeping core business logic decoupled from framework specific details

  • Investing in automated tests so you can refactor or migrate with confidence

If you treat your framework as a tool rather than as a religion, you can evolve your stack over time without rewriting everything.

Hire remote developers

Author Profile: Mahipal Nehra is the Digital Marketing Manager at Decipher Zone Technologies, specializing in SEO, content strategy, and tech-driven marketing for software development and digital transformation.

Follow us on LinkedIn or explore more insights at Decipher Zone.